In North Tyneside, we have been operating three GP-led vaccination centres within North Tyneside since the 15th December 2020. These centres have been running frequently since December and operate alongside the national mass vaccination centres. We are pleased to announce that 70,729 of our residents have received their first dose of the COVID-19 vaccine. This means that 41.5% of North Tyneside residents have good protection from coronavirus, but longer lasting protection when the second dose is administered. Currently only residents which are aged 16 and above can receive the COVID-19 vaccine.

 

(data as at 11th March 2021, source NHSE Statistical website)
